5 Top Secret Techniques To Make Your Adsense Website Stick

Without a doubt you need traffic to your Adsense website since
your income from Google depends on it.
It's the problem which most people have problems with. If you
can make your visitors stick to your website then the traffic you
create should accumulate - problem solved.
Making that traffic return is the major challenge and one of the
so called "secrets" of build a successful Adsense website.
What is better than having visitors continuing to return to your
website, without any effort on your part? You definitely need to
make your Adsense website sticky and below are my 5 tips to
achieve this.
1. Have good, interesting content. This is the one of the main
reasons why I favour blogs advertising Adsense. You can easily
write content and update it on your website.
It's much easier updating a blog than a website. Unless of
course, your website has a content management system (CMS) like a
blog.
People browse on the internet to read content. So if the
information provided by you is good and it is updated on a
regular basis, the user will bookmark your site and will return.
Even possibly a few times a week to read your content.
2. Having a newsletter subscription or a mini course sign up form
on the front of your website. Once visitors sign up to your form,
they are on your email list.
You can use an autoresponder to follow up with them and also
email to notify them that your content is updated.
Having your visitors go on your email list will remind them of
your existence so that they visit you again. However, you have to
make sure that your mini-course provides good content so they
will read it.
You can see how I do this with my 7 part mini-course by sending a
blank mail to my autoresponder at ne-mini@onlinemoney
This is my step-by-step mini-course on making money with
Adsense.
3. Having a forum on your website. With good content you will
attract interested visitors to your website. These visitors love
to share and discuss what they are passionate about.
A forum will act as a regular gathering place for them which
means repeated visits and also increase in Adsense clicks.
4. Announcing upcoming events. In your content, you should always
specify what is coming up in the next few days. Such as updated
report on your particular niche.
This will increase the visitor's awareness of your website and
they will remember to visit your website again sometime in the
future to check out what you mentioned before.
This is a very powerful technique to build repeat visitors and it
only requires a mention of what is coming in the next few days.
5. The last technique to ensure repeat visitors is to have a
schedule of the updates to your website and stick to it. If your
blog advertising Google Adsense is rarely updated, the chances of
the visitor coming back is near zero.
People love reading good content but if they return and find that
your content is the same they will rarely return. The reason is
because they have a lot of other choices. The web is so
clickable, you've got to get their attention.
If you stick to having updates on regular basis such as once in 2
days, then the visitor will return to read the latest on your
website.
This concludes the 5 ways to having a sticky Adsense website. The
best thing is to implement all 5 techniques to your website.
Getting traffic is not an easy thing so make sure the traffic is
your regular customer. A regular customer gives you business
which in this case is Adsense income.
